sisong / HDiffPatch

a C\C++ library and command-line tools for Diff & Patch between binary files or directories(folder); cross-platform; runs fast; create small delta/differential; support large files and limit memory requires when diff & patch.
Other
1.52k stars 280 forks source link

divsufsort和sdt sort有多大差距? #380

Closed RPG3D closed 4 months ago

RPG3D commented 5 months ago

尝试把代码往其他工程嵌入遇到了符号冲突 divsufsort定义了2次(64版本被define了一次),打算改用std sort,不知道影响多大

sisong commented 5 months ago

排序上,divsufsort快很多倍。
建议重构一下代码,比如改名或用namespace。